Supporting Structural and Keyword Search for XML Data

碩士 === 國立臺灣海洋大學 === 資訊工程學系 === 94 === Abstract In this thesis, we discuss how to use the technology of Information Retrieval to combine with the XQuery Query Processing algorithm, so that we could retrieve the data that conforms the structural and value constraints imposed by users. To process the s...

Full description

Bibliographic Details
Main Authors: Chieh-Chang Luo, 羅介璋
Other Authors: Ya-Hui Chang
Format: Others
Language:zh-TW
Published: 2006
Online Access:http://ndltd.ncl.edu.tw/handle/85328509214377290085
id ndltd-TW-094NTOU5392014
record_format oai_dc
spelling ndltd-TW-094NTOU53920142016-06-01T04:25:08Z http://ndltd.ncl.edu.tw/handle/85328509214377290085 Supporting Structural and Keyword Search for XML Data 支援XML文件結構與關鍵字查詢之研究 Chieh-Chang Luo 羅介璋 碩士 國立臺灣海洋大學 資訊工程學系 94 Abstract In this thesis, we discuss how to use the technology of Information Retrieval to combine with the XQuery Query Processing algorithm, so that we could retrieve the data that conforms the structural and value constraints imposed by users. To process the structural constraints, we propose to decompose the query tree into a sequence of suffix paths. Each suffix path consists of only parent-child relationship between nodes. Then, the system will retrieve elements that correspond to each suffix path, and combine those elements to form the final result. The XML data will be pre-processed and represented in the internal form. Basically, we assign each possible path in XML data a P-Label. Each path is associated with an Element-Encoding table, which records the structural and value information for all the elements which correspond to this P-Label. To meet the requirement of information retrieval, we adopt the BM25 Scoring Model to pre-compute the scores between elements and keywords and store the scores within the associated Element-Encoding Table. Therefore, we can efficiently determine if the element’s keyword satisfies user’s value constraint and find the corresponding score. We have performed a series of experiments to evaluate the performance of the proposed approach. We also contrast with a well-known system. The experimental results show that our system is very efficient. Ya-Hui Chang 張雅惠 2006 學位論文 ; thesis 74 zh-TW
collection NDLTD
language zh-TW
format Others
sources NDLTD
description 碩士 === 國立臺灣海洋大學 === 資訊工程學系 === 94 === Abstract In this thesis, we discuss how to use the technology of Information Retrieval to combine with the XQuery Query Processing algorithm, so that we could retrieve the data that conforms the structural and value constraints imposed by users. To process the structural constraints, we propose to decompose the query tree into a sequence of suffix paths. Each suffix path consists of only parent-child relationship between nodes. Then, the system will retrieve elements that correspond to each suffix path, and combine those elements to form the final result. The XML data will be pre-processed and represented in the internal form. Basically, we assign each possible path in XML data a P-Label. Each path is associated with an Element-Encoding table, which records the structural and value information for all the elements which correspond to this P-Label. To meet the requirement of information retrieval, we adopt the BM25 Scoring Model to pre-compute the scores between elements and keywords and store the scores within the associated Element-Encoding Table. Therefore, we can efficiently determine if the element’s keyword satisfies user’s value constraint and find the corresponding score. We have performed a series of experiments to evaluate the performance of the proposed approach. We also contrast with a well-known system. The experimental results show that our system is very efficient.
author2 Ya-Hui Chang
author_facet Ya-Hui Chang
Chieh-Chang Luo
羅介璋
author Chieh-Chang Luo
羅介璋
spellingShingle Chieh-Chang Luo
羅介璋
Supporting Structural and Keyword Search for XML Data
author_sort Chieh-Chang Luo
title Supporting Structural and Keyword Search for XML Data
title_short Supporting Structural and Keyword Search for XML Data
title_full Supporting Structural and Keyword Search for XML Data
title_fullStr Supporting Structural and Keyword Search for XML Data
title_full_unstemmed Supporting Structural and Keyword Search for XML Data
title_sort supporting structural and keyword search for xml data
publishDate 2006
url http://ndltd.ncl.edu.tw/handle/85328509214377290085
work_keys_str_mv AT chiehchangluo supportingstructuralandkeywordsearchforxmldata
AT luójièzhāng supportingstructuralandkeywordsearchforxmldata
AT chiehchangluo zhīyuánxmlwénjiànjiégòuyǔguānjiànzìcháxúnzhīyánjiū
AT luójièzhāng zhīyuánxmlwénjiànjiégòuyǔguānjiànzìcháxúnzhīyánjiū
_version_ 1718291667360940032